Guida Python – manuale completo in italiano

(*8*)

Impara a programmare con Python grazie alla nostra guida in italiano, gratuita e completa. Scopri le caratteristiche, los angeles sintassi e le easiest pratctices according to programmare utilizzando questo linguaggio orientato agli oggetti estremamente semplice e potente.

  • 1 (*13*) Introduzione al linguaggio Python

    Python è un linguaggio according to los angeles programmazione e lo scripting implementanto sotto licenza Open Supply; una delle sue caratteristiche più rilevanti…

    9.151 lettori

  • 2 (*20*) Installazione di Python

    Nel momento in cui viene scritta questa trattazione los angeles versione più recente di Python è los angeles 3.4.3, mentre l’ultima unencumber della versione 2.x è s…

    7.746 lettori

  • 3 (*4*) Los angeles nostra prima applicazione con Python: Ciao Mondo!

    Di default Python offre un potente strumento according to los angeles programmazione denominato IDLE, esso mette a disposizione un’interfaccia grafica con los angeles quale l…

    10.336 lettori

  • 4 Le variabili in Python

    Le variabili sono dei costrutti comuni a quasi tutti i linguaggi di programmazione, esse nascono dall’esigenza di avere a disposizione uno spazio d…

    11.339 lettori

  • 5 Gli operatori di Python

    Gli operatori non sono un’esclusiva di Python, in generale tutti i linguaggi di programmazione e sviluppo dispongono di questi costrutti sintattici…

    8.481 lettori

  • 6 (*15*) I costrutti condizionali

    Come los angeles maggior parte dei linguaggi according to los angeles programmazione e lo sviluppo anche Python mette a disposizione dei coders i cosiddetti costrutti condizi…

    10.713 lettori

  • 7 Il ciclo for

    Il ciclo (loop) for è uno dei cicli di iterazione messi a disposizione dal linguaggio Python, si tratta in sostanza di un costrutto, comune anche…

    11.531 lettori

  • 8 Il ciclo whilst

    Vediamo come funziona il ciclo whilst in Python attraverso una spiegazione teorica e tanti esempi pratici di utilizzo.

    7.905 lettori

  • 9 (*7*) Controllo del flusso di esecuzione con smash e proceed

    Terminare un ciclo con smash Grazie agli esempi proposti in precedenza è stato possibile introdurre l’istruzione smash, quest’ultima, quando impi…

    3.721 lettori

  • 10 Definire funzioni

    E’ possibile definire le funzioni come degli insiemi composti da una o più istruzioni necessarie according to lo svolgimento di un determinato compito; uno…

    5.777 lettori

  • 11 (*9*) Gestire gli argomenti delle funzioni in Python

    In keeping with los angeles definizione delle funzioni in Python è necessario tener presente alcune regole sintattiche in modo da evitare los angeles generazione di errori. Vi…

    4.044 lettori

  • 12 (*10*) Funzioni Lambda e ricorsione in Python

    Funzioni anonime In Python le funzioni Lamba sono dei particolari costrutti sintattici derivati dal linguaggio Lisp e chiamati anche funzioni anon…

    5.030 lettori

  • 13 Le liste in Python

    In Python è possibile definire una lista, alla quale si potrà attribuire un nome, inserendo degli elementi tra parentesi quadre (“[..]”…

    5.386 lettori

  • 14 (*19*) Gestione delle liste in Python

    Modificare gli elementi di una lista Gli elementi presenti all’interno di una lista potranno essere modificati dinamicamente; nel prossimo capito…

    7.265 lettori

  • 15 Le tuple in Python

    Come anticipato, le tuple sono dei costrutti che, come accade according to le liste, possono contenere una raccolta di elementi; los angeles differenza sostanziale t…

    2.785 lettori

  • 16 Gestire le tuple in Python

    Come anticipato, le tuple si differenziano dalle liste soprattutto according to by means of del fatto di essere immutabili, una volta che viene assegnato un component…

    2.328 lettori

  • 17 Funzioni according to liste e tuple

    In Python le funzioni local according to le liste e le tuple sono le medesime, presentano gli stessi nomi e los angeles stessa sintassi e prevedono gli stessi valor…

    2.878 lettori

  • 18 I set in Python

    I set sono delle entità simili alle liste e alle tuple, essi sono definibili come delle raccolte non ordinate di elementi in cui ciascuno di essi…

    3.631 lettori

  • 19 Operare con i set in Python

    Le funzioni disponibili in Python according to i set sono in linea di massima le stesse descritte in precedenza according to le liste e le tuple, motivo according to il quale…

    1.853 lettori

  • 20 I dizionari in Python

    In Python i dizionari (dictionary), o semplicemente dict, sono delle raccolte non ordinate di oggetti che appartengono ai cosiddetti tipi di dato c…

    6.661 lettori

  • 21 (*12*) Operazioni sui dizionari in Python

    I dizionari in Python sono dei costrutti iterabili, questa caratteristica li rende particolarmente utili nelle operazioni che prevedono los angeles selezion…

    3.867 lettori

  • 22 I moduli in Python

    In Python un modulo è essenzialmente un record che contiene del codice scritto in questo linguaggio. I moduli sono caratterizzati dall’estensione…

    3.297 lettori

  • 23 (*1*) Moduli Python: listing, namespace e variabili d’ambiente

    In keeping with utilizzare al meglio i moduli è fondamentale capire come essi vengono gestiti da Python, approfondire questo argomento consente di scoprire l’…

    2.371 lettori

  • 24 I package deal in Python

    I moduli possono essere considerati sia dei contenitori (di definizioni, istruzioni, metodi..) che dei contenuti collezionabili all’interno di insi…

    1.239 lettori

  • 25 Gestire i record con Python

    Vediamo le funzioni local che Python mette a disposizione degli sviluppatori according to aprire, leggere, scrivere e chiudere un record.

    8.870 lettori

  • 26 (*17*) Operare con le listing in Python

    Come qualsiasi altro linguaggio di programmazione, Python individua le listing in quanto insiemi di record e sotto-cartelle, listing vuote verran…

    10.581 lettori

  • 27 (*16*) Gestione delle eccezioni in Python

    Possiamo definire un’eccezione come il costrutto di un linguaggio che, in presenza di un’anomalia, genera un messaggio di errore. Quando si verifi…

    1.010 lettori

  • 28 (*11*) OOP in Python: classi, oggetti e metodi

    Python supporta diversi paradigmi according to los angeles programmazione compreso l’OOP (Object-Orientated Programming, programmazione orientata agli oggetti), un app…

    4.178 lettori

  • 29 (*18*) OOP: ereditarietà in Python

    L’ereditarietà è un meccanismo grazie al quale una classe derivata (o kid magnificence) può acquisire le funzionalità particular in una classe base (o…

    1.864 lettori

  • 30 OOP: incapsulamento e polimorfismo in Python

    Il paradigma OOP non nasce soltanto according to garantire una maggiore riutilizzabilità del codice, ma anche according to favorire lo sviluppo collaborativo, le cl…

    2.525 lettori

  • 31 (*6*) Python e MySQL: connessione e creazione del database

    MySQL è un DBMS (Database Control Device) di tipo relazionale, ciò significa che le informazioni archviate e gestite attraverso di esso sono i…

    3 lettori

  • 32 (*2*) Python e MySQL: creazione di una tabella e definizione dei campi

    Un database relazionale gestito tramite MySQL è composto da una o più tabelle destinate advert ospitare dei dati, questi ultimi vengono ordinati in r…

    3 lettori

  • 33 (*5*) Python e MySQL: inserimento e aggiornamento dei dati

    Una volta creata una tabella con i relativi campi è possibile popolarla tramite l’inserimento dei dati. Quando si gestisce un database MySQL story…

    3 lettori

  • 34 (*14*) Python e MySQL: selezione dei document

    Dopo aver inserito i dati all’interno di una tabella una delle operazioni più frequenti a carico dei database è quella relativa alla selezione de…

    3 lettori

  • 35 (*3*) Python e MySQL: cancellare document, tabelle e database

    Tra le process effettuate con una certa frequenza nella gestione dei database vi sono anche quelle che prevedono los angeles rimozione di document, tabelle…

    2 lettori